Where do I get a STATE Fishing license?
A North Carolina Fishng License is required for individuals 16 years of age or more. A fishing license is required to fish any public water in North Carolina. The State of North Carolina requires seperate licenses to be purchased for inland and salt water fishing. When fishing with a licensed captain or guide in saltwater no licensing is needed.
